Hi Isaac, please note that we are not adding the header (or footer) to our HTML documents. The module manual should be just the most inner part of HTML document starting just with a heading. Note also that we are now trying to avoid the uppercase tags in HTML (this is the common and stable trend in past years). Let us now if something is not clear, so we can fix that.
